Lufthansa to Join the Premium Economy Crowd
Thursday, December 6, 2012 at 3:16PM Lufthansa (LH) will equip its entire intercontinental fleet with a Premium Economy cabin, joining the ranks of Virgin Atlantic, United Airlines, Delta and Air New Zealand and more that have plugged the chasm between Economy - little changed in decades - and Business - which has been transformed into a cocoon of comfort over the last decade.
Its unclear yet as to what Lufthansa will decide upon in terms of layout and amenities. With United and Delta's product little more than extra legroom, Virgin Atlantic and Air New Zealand's products feature an entirely different seat, seat pitch and inflight catering.
The vastly different offerings make Premium Economy the most confusing of cabin products, and it pays to research the quality carefully before purchase.
